Inscription
THIS WINDOW IS ERECTED IN MEMORY OF/ MICHAEL CONDRAN BY HIS RELATIVES/ AND OF THE/ MEMBERS OF THE CONGREGATION WHO FELL IN THE GREAT WAR 1914 - 1918/ (NAMES)/ REQUIESCANT IN PACE
